SHOOTING FATALITY
(By Telegraph.—Press Association.)
DUNEDIN, This Day.
A shooting fatality occurred at Waitahuna on Wednesday, the victim being a storekeeper, E. S. Blair, who went put shooting late in the after noon. \He was found later with a bullet in the head. In getting .through a fence he had caught his foot and fallen, the rifle going off as he fell.
